• DocumentCode
    302894
  • Title

    A macro expansion approach to embedded processor code generation

  • Author

    Lassila, Eero

  • Author_Institution
    Digital Syst. Lab., Helsinki Univ. of Technol., Espoo, Finland
  • fYear
    1996
  • fDate
    2-5 Sep 1996
  • Firstpage
    136
  • Lastpage
    142
  • Abstract
    This paper describes an experimental prototype of a code generation tool for embedded special-purpose processors. The tool is a retargetable assembly-code-level macro expander capable of program flow analysis. The main advantage of the tool is its strong support for macro hierarchy: hierarchical macro libraries make the code (produced either by the compiler writer or by the assembly language programmer) more modular
  • Keywords
    assembly language; computer architecture; real-time systems; assembly language programmer; compiler writer; embedded processor code generation; embedded special-purpose processors; hierarchical macro libraries; macro expansion approach; program flow analysis; retargetable assembly-code-level macro expander; Assembly; Digital signal processors; Digital systems; High level languages; Laboratories; Libraries; Program processors; Programming profession; Prototypes; Registers;
  • fLanguage
    English
  • Publisher
    ieee
  • Conference_Titel
    EUROMICRO 96. Beyond 2000: Hardware and Software Design Strategies., Proceedings of the 22nd EUROMICRO Conference
  • Conference_Location
    Prague
  • ISSN
    1089-6503
  • Print_ISBN
    0-8186-7487-3
  • Type

    conf

  • DOI
    10.1109/EURMIC.1996.546375
  • Filename
    546375